The Cuban Revolution led to Batista's removal and Castro's rise to power. Initially, Castro was head of the army, with Urrutia as president and Miró as prime minister. Castro's policies, including nationalization, angered the US and led to tensions. The CIA's attempts to overthrow Castro failed, culminating in the Bay of Pigs invasion, which was a disaster for the US. This failure increased Cuba's reliance on the Soviet Union, setting the stage for the Cuban Missile Crisis.
